As they become more sophisticated, private investors seek to develop and refine their skills. The "Wiley Traders' Quest" series seeks to provide the serious equity investor with a host of ideas and insights into the minutiae of investing from the top stock market players around the world. This book is a compilation of interviews looking at investing across international borders and globalization in general. Interviewees include Mark Mobius, Dean Lebaron, Peter Everington, Marc Faber, Robert Prechter, Jim Rogers, Paul Melton and Alfred Steinherr.
